There’s no such thing as a free lunch, and even though Trading 212, like Investor Centre, offers commission-free stock trading the fact remains that there are still costs to be considered – including spreads and taxes. But if you’re willing to accept those extras, then both platforms are legitimate digital stockbrokers, authorised and regulated by the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A). And should either of them fail your investments are protected up to PS85,000 per person via the Financial Services Compensation Scheme.

Getting started is relatively simple, whether on mobile or desktop. After deciding whether to open an Invest or ISA account (the latter only available for UK residents), you’re invited to verify your identity and deposit at least the minimum amount of money – usually PS1 or EUR1.

Once you’re in the market, Trading 212 does its best to keep things as straightforward as possible. For example, if you’re looking to buy shares in Tesla – a stock popular with many investors – you can do so straight from the app by clicking on the relevant symbol. This brings up a little information box which includes a chart showing the stock’s performance, plus income and balance sheet data.

The platform is also one of the very few to offer fractional shares, which can help you diversify your portfolio with a smaller sum of money. Similarly, its Pie and Autoinvest features allow you to set up dividend reinvesting and automatic rebalancing, respectively. Unlike rivals like Hargreaves Lansdown, however, Trading 212 does not currently offer mutual funds or bonds.

Some of the most popular investment trading apps in the UK are eToro, IG, and Moneybox. eToro offers a multi-asset trading platform that allows you to trade stocks, ETFs, currencies, cryptocurrencies, and commodities. It also provides a variety of educational tools and market research. In addition, it’s one of the most affordable trading apps in the world.

With IG, you can invest in a wide range of assets, including stocks, shares, CFDs, and forex. Its intuitive platform, detailed market research, and robust trading tools make it an ideal choice for both beginner and advanced traders. Its fees are competitive, and it offers a number of benefits, including a free demo account.

Meanwhile, Moneybox is one of the most accessible investment platforms in the UK, allowing you to start with as little as PS1. In California, personal injuries occur when someone suffers emotional or financial harm due to the negligent actions of another party. This broad definition covers a wide variety of incidents, including car accidents, dog bites, and slip and fall injuries.

A skilled Sacramento personal injury lawyer will ensure that you are fully evaluated by trusted medical professionals and provided with a treatment plan. They will also work with financial and economic experts to properly calculate all your expected costs. These include a loss of enjoyment or quality of life, pain and suffering, diminished earning capacity, a loss of consortium, and more.

An experienced attorney will fight aggressively against insurance companies on your behalf to get you the compensation you deserve. They will also keep you updated on the status of your case and address any concerns or questions you have along the way. In addition, they will make sure you file a claim within the statute of limitations, which is usually two years from the date of your injury. However, the statute of limitations may be paused in some cases, such as when a minor is injured.
